div居中代码
html div怎么垂直居中显示
在HTML页面布局中,让div元素居中的方法主要有两种:margin方法和position方法。这两种方法都能有效地实现div元素的水平和垂直居中。使用margin方法,可以通过设置div的左右margin值使其居中。方法让一个DIV水平居中,直接用CSS就可以做到。只要设置了DIV的宽度,然后使用margin设置边距0auto,CSS自动算出左右边距,使得DIV居中。将标签A的文本垂直居中非常简单,只需设置css的line-height属性,通过将像素值设置为相同的高度来垂直居中。我们在设计页面的时候,经常要把DIV居中显示,而且是相对页面窗口水平和垂直方向居中显示,如让登录窗口居中显示。到现在为止,探讨了很多种方法。首先先打开我们的开发环境新建一个web项目。在html中引入css文件这里是html页面的代码div和ul。将所有标签的margin和padding初始为0然后将父级div的display设置为flexalign-items设置为center。运行web项目后得到的结果如图所示垂直居中了。
div块居中问题
然后我们设置Div的边距,第一个参数指示顶部的距离为第二个自动表示自动。也就是说,在设置此设置后,div将根据页面自动居中。浏览效果好后,您可以看到此时DIV块已自动居它与浏览器的左右两侧距离相同。1主要的核心思想就是给div设置margin:0auto,这样就能居中。在body中添加一个DIV,并引入一个CSS,命名为。z-index是让DIV模块始终在最上端,也可以不添加。1。创建一个新的html文件,命名为test.html,解释CSS如何使一个div居中。在test.html文件中,使用div标签创建一个模块来测试居中效果。在test.html文件中,将div的class属性设置为test,然后通过这个class属性设置它的css样式。编写标签,页面的css样式将被写入其中。50%,就是在距屏幕左方或祖先元素50%,因为它是以『左上角』为基准偏移的,它现在距离左边是:50%+400px,这个块的左上角在屏幕的中间,但是这个块元素不在屏幕中间,所以margin-left:-200px;把它想左边拉回一半,它就在屏幕中间了!margin-top:-80px;和上面的原理一样。往上拉回去一半。。
html代码布局居中问题
水平居中使用text-align属性。在父级元素中设置text-align为center,子元素即水平居中。如:这样文本会居中显示在父元素中。利用margin属性。为需要居中的元素添加margin属性,左右margin值设为auto,实现水平居中。如:该div元素将水平居中。通过Flexbox布局。打开HTML的编辑器。找到需要居中的图片或者文字。在body里面,设置CSS样式。添加样式为:text-align:center;即可。超文本标记语言(HyperTextMarkupLanguage),缩写为HTML,标准通用标记语言下的一个应用。如何用html代码实现网页上下居中?其原理很简单,就是把块级元素变成行内元素,定义样式vertical-align:middle,让其垂直居中。这里面有两个难点,怎样把块级元素变成行内元素并可以定义大小,而且还要兼容(要了解IElayout)。打开HTML的编辑器。找到需要居中的图片或者文字。在body里面,设置CSS样式。
css怎么让div上下居中,靠右对齐
方法使用margin属性实现水平居中对于单个div元素,可以通过设置左右margin为auto来实现水平居中。这种方法适用于宽度固定的div。例如,给div设置一个固定的宽度,然后将左右margin都设置为auto,浏览器会自动计算并均匀分配两侧空白,使div水平居中。另一种方法是利用position:absolute;。将小div设为绝对定位,设置left和top为`auto`,可以让小div在大div中水平和垂直居中。具体可以分为两种情况:一是指定left和top的精确像素值,二是将left和top设置为百分比,使其相对于大div的尺寸进行居中。实现DIV水平居中设置DIV的宽高,使用margin设置边距0auto,CSS自动算出左右边距,使得DIV居中。几种居中CSSdiv的方法CSS实现div垂直居中的方法有很多。下面这些使div居中的方法在编写网页时经常用到,最常见的例子就是登录注册弹出框。方法使用绝对布局位置:absolutefordiv并设置top、left、right、bottom的值相等,但不一定都等于0;并设置边距:自动。方法这个方法需要知道div的宽度和高度。
怎么让div中的div上下居中
使用margin属性,设置margin-top和margin-left为正值,这将使div元素在垂直和水平方向上居中。通过设置position属性为relative,然后使用margin:0auto,div元素会在水平方向上自动居中,配合margin-top调整垂直方向。让div中的div居中可以通过CSS的margin属性或flexbox布局实现。通过CSS的margin属性实现居中这是一种常见的方法,主要通过设置左右margin为auto来实现。给内层的div设置一个宽度,然后将其左右margin设置为auto,这样浏览器会自动计算左右两侧的空间,使div水平居中。使用margin方法,可以通过设置div的左右margin值使其居中。具体操作是,计算父元素宽度减去div宽度后除以得到的值设置为margin-left,同时计算父元素高度减去div高度后除以作为margin-top。先给一个大的div作为父容器.给他设置好宽,高。父容器设置为position:relative子容器(想要居中的容器),设置position:absolute;在设置margin-top,margin-right等等,如果想要绝对居中,可设置如下CSS样式。
如何在多个div中的div居中
1。要让DIV水平和垂直居中,必需知道该DIV得宽度和高度,然后设置位置为绝对位置,距离页面窗口左边框和上边框的距离设置为50%,这个50%就是指页面窗口的宽度和高度的50%,最后将该DIV分别左移和上移,左移和上移的大小就是该DIV宽度和高度的一半。方法使用绝对布局位置:absolutefordiv并设置top、left、right、bottom的值相等,但不一定都等于0;并设置边距:自动。方法这个方法需要知道div的宽度和高度。使用绝对布局位置:绝对用于div并将top和left的值设置为50%;50%是指页面窗口宽度和高度的50%;最后,将div向左上方移动div宽度和高度的一半。在CSS中,有多种方法可以实现div元素的居中对齐,以下是其中的几种策略:当外部大div和内部小div的宽度和高度都已知且固定时,可以使用margin属性让小div居中。只需为小div设置`margin:auto`即可实现。另一种方法是利用position:absolute;。
感谢您花时间阅读本文。如果您觉得这篇文章对您有帮助,请与我们分享您的经验。